How Much Does a Replacement Key For Car Cost?

In the past, losing keys to your car was a minor inconvenience. But nowadays, the mistake can cost you a significant sum of money.

The cost of the key that you have in your vehicle will depend on the year, model and model. The easiest key to replace is a simple metal one, which can be easily cut by an automotive locksmith.

Transponder Key

If your car is equipped with transponder keys, it's going to cost more to replace than a standard key. The keys are equipped with a chip which communicates with the vehicle to turn it on or shut the doors. The key needs to be programmed correctly for it to function. Auto locksmiths can replace keys for transponders for a lot less than the retail price.

Dealerships also charge a premium for replacing these keys since they are the only ones to make keys for their customers. You can save money by searching online for locksmiths that specialize in your specific car model. It's likely they will be able to cut keys that are standard, as well as programme the transponder chip into your car.

The chips were first introduced into automobiles in 1998. They are designed to reduce car thefts, by preventing people from using connect a car to a hot wire without the correct key. They work by sending a signal from the ignition to the key which turns on the car. The chip is equipped with a digital serial number that authenticates the key in order to enable it to function and also assists in stopping thieves from copying and using fake keys.

Most modern cars come with chip keys as well as the traditional flat metal key that opens the door and operate locks in the event of need. Most of the time, these keys are kept in separate places and are used as backup keys or for emergencies.

You can purchase a non-transponder key from a local hardware store, like Home Depot or Walmart, for a fairly inexpensive price. These keys won't start your vehicle however they can be used to unlock your doors if you're locked out. Some of these keys are even compatible with certain car immobilizer systems that stop your car from starting if key that is not compatible is used.


You can get an additional key to your vehicle by contacting an auto locksmith. You can locate one online or by calling a local locksmith business. Auto locksmiths can be a good choice because they are typically 20% cheaper than car dealerships. They are also able to offer emergency service for situations such as being locked out of your vehicle.

Keyless Entry Remote

Key fobs can let you start and lock your car even when the metal part of the key isn't in the ignition. This kind of key is most commonly found in modern European vehicles and can cost between $200 to $500 to replace. They use rolling-code encryption to keep thieves from copying them and taking the vehicle. Typically, these types keys must be replaced through an authorized dealer and cannot be copied by hardware stores.

A traditional key fob which makes use of a simple push-button to open doors, is usually priced between $20 and $50 to replace. They are popular targets for thieves so it's important to have an extra mechanical key. Transponder keys with modern technology are slightly more expensive at between $100 and $150, however they come with additional security features that make them less likely to be stolen.

The smart key is the most sophisticated key fob. It's about smaller than an ordinary key, and it has a metal key that pops up from the plastic when the button on the key is pressed. This type of key is the most difficult to steal and is usually included with other features of premium quality like navigation systems in higher trim levels or technology packages. Smart keys range from $250-$500.

Certain of these modern key fobs are able to be copied by hardware stores, but others must be purchased through a dealer. In general, it is more expensive to get the replacement of a smart key because they require a sophisticated remote entry procedure to be programmed to work with the vehicle.

The key fob itself will vary in price based on the manufacturer and the design of the key. Most of the time you'll be able purchase an alternative at your local auto parts shop for lower cost than what you can get at an auto dealer. You may also have to pay extra for the process of programming the replacement key fob for your vehicle, which is done by a locksmith or at the dealer's service department.

Car Key Replacement

It's difficult to find your car keys. It doesn't just stop you from driving your vehicle but also makes it impossible to get around if you're stuck. There are some steps you can do to make the process simpler and cheaper.

The most cost-effective and easiest option is to find an auto locksmith near you who specializes in car keys. A professional locksmith can replace an old metal key fob in a matter of minutes. They can also design replacement keys for older vehicles that have a traditional mechanical key without chip. There are also discounted keys for cars on the internet, but you'll need to verify the details of your vehicle and determine if the keys fit the model you've got.

More advanced keys are more difficult to duplicate and require a specific key programming machine that only a few auto dealerships have. You can try some of these devices at home, but you should go to a professional if your car key is lost or you need to make an extra. The cost ranges from $125 for basic transponder keys, and up to $300 for the advanced flip or "switchblade" type that opens doors and starts the engine by pressing a button pressing.

Some dealers will provide key replacements for free if you have proof of ownership, such as a registration or title. This service is usually included in roadside assistance add-ons, or a comprehensive bumper-to-bumper guarantee.

Most locksmiths in the automotive industry are able to replace keys for cars but they might not have the equipment to program newer keys. If you can locate your car keys, a simple copy can be purchased for $10 or less at the local hardware store. The most difficult keys to duplicate are the modern fob style keys that allow you to unlock and open your doors with the button. Key fobs have a microchip that must be paired to your vehicle in order to unlock and start the car. They can be reprogrammed by a locksmith for a higher cost, or you can try it at the dealership.
